Pros

The best part I liked was the experience I got with the kids that were being held in detention. You got a chance to see their viewpoints and backgrounds of where they came from.

Cons

Workers never got an opportunity to help the kids grow, hours were terrible only received 20 min breaks because of shirt staffing. Gave the kids too much power at certain points, discipline system is terrible
